National 5 Mathematics: applications

Applications is the part of National 5 Maths that looks least like algebra: money growing or shrinking year on year, fractions, vectors, and the handful of statistics a candidate is expected to calculate and interpret. This set covers appreciation and depreciation over several years, reversing a percentage increase, dividing mixed numbers, adding vectors and finding a magnitude, the interquartile range, what a larger standard deviation actually tells you, reading a prediction off a line of best fit, and working out the saving in a three-for-two offer.

The percentage questions are built around the mistake that costs most marks: treating repeated percentage change as a single multiplication, so that three years of 15 per cent depreciation becomes 45 per cent off. Both of those wrong answers are offered, along with the value after stopping a year early. The statistics questions separate the three numbers that get confused with each other — the range, the median and the interquartile range are all among the options, so only the right calculation picks the right one.

  • Calculate appreciation and depreciation over several years by compounding, not by multiplying the rate
  • Reverse a percentage increase by dividing by the multiplier
  • Divide mixed numbers by converting to improper fractions and multiplying by the reciprocal
  • Add vectors by components and find a magnitude using Pythagoras
  • Find quartiles from an ordered list and calculate the interquartile range
  • Interpret what a larger standard deviation means when two means are equal
  • Predict a value from the equation of a line of best fit
  • Work out the percentage saved on a multi-buy offer

A car is worth 12 000 pounds and depreciates by 15 per cent each year. What is its value after 3 years? — $12\,000 \times 0.85^3 = 12\,000 \times 0.614125 = 7369.50$ pounds.

Sample question

A house is valued at 180 000 pounds and appreciates by 5 per cent each year. What is its value after 2 years?

See the answer

198 450 pounds

The value is calculated using compound appreciation: $180 000 \times 1.05^2 = 180 000 \times 1.1025 = 198 450$. The option 198 000 pounds is a common error resulting from simple interest ($180 000 + 180 000 \times 0.05 \times 2$).
